Explanation
Addition, subtraction, multiplication, and division can be performed between channels.
Computation Target Channel
CH1 to CH16, DSP1 to DSP6 (optional), and Math1 to Math8
Setting the Computation Range: Start Point/End Point
By default, the measurement range is
±
5 divisions of the display frame on the time axis.
You can limit this range.
The concept of the computation range is analogous to the concept of the selectable
range of cursor display position in cursor measurement.
For details, see section 11.5, “Selectable Range of Cursor Position.”
Setting the Scaling
Set the upper and lower limits of the math waveform display.
Auto:
The upper and lower limits are set according to the computed result.
Manual:
The upper and lower limits can be set arbitrarily. The range is from –
9.9999E+30 to 9.9999E+30.
Setting the Unit
Unit can be set arbitrarily using up to four characters. The specified characters are
applied to the scale values.
Linear Scaling
When performing computation on a channel that has linear scaling set, the computation
is performed on the scaled value.
Notes when Performing Computation
Computation is not performed again when you change Start Point or End Point while
computation is stopped. Be sure to press the Exec soft key to perform the computation
again. Otherwise, the waveform will not be displayed correctly when the screen is
redrawn.
